fix admin nav bar

This commit is contained in:
Torsten Ruger 2017-08-01 07:20:08 +03:00
parent 9367b90ad1
commit 92043efa0b
1 changed files with 12 additions and 8 deletions

View File

@ -1,11 +1,15 @@
%nav.navbar.navbar-fixed-top.navbar-light
%button.navbar-toggler.hidden-md-up{"aria-controls" => "navbarResponsive", "aria-expanded" => "false", "aria-label" => "Toggle navigation", "data-target" => "#navbarResponsive", "data-toggle" => "collapse", :type => "button"}
#navbarResponsive.collapse.navbar-toggleable-sm
%a.navbar-brand{:href => page_path(:index) }
= #image_tag "logos/web_logo.png" , class: :desktop
%ul.nav.navbar-nav.float-sm-right
%nav.navbar.fixed-top.navbar-toggleable-sm.navbar-light
%button.navbar-toggler.navbar-toggler-right{"aria-controls" => "navbarNav",
"aria-expanded" => "false",
"aria-label" => "Toggle navigation",
"data-target" => "#navbarResponsive",
"data-toggle" => "collapse",
:type => "button"}
%span.navbar-toggler-icon
#navbarResponsive.collapse.navbar-collapse
%ul.navbar-nav.ml-auto
- { "Users" => admin_users_path , "Resumes" => admin_resumes_path ,
"Applies" => admin_applies_path , "Courses" => admin_courses_path }.each do | menu, slug|
"Applies" => admin_applies_path , "Courses" => admin_courses_path ,
"Home" => page_path(:index)}.each do | menu, slug|
%li.nav-item{class: (request.path == slug) && "active" }
=link_to menu , slug ,class: "nav-link"
%li.nav-item.nav-small= sign_out_link class: "nav-link"